Original Description
The vibrant painting Rotterdam by French artist Maurice Denis (1870-1943) captures the bustling energy of the Dutch port city through his signature Post-Impressionist style. Created in 1896 during Denis's travels through the Netherlands, the work exemplifies his theory of "flat surfaces covered with colors assembled in a certain order"—merging decorative harmony with symbolic meaning. Dominated by rhythmic brushstrokes and warm ochres contrasting with cool blues, the composition depicts quayside activity with simplified, almost dreamlike figures. As a founding member of Les Nabis, Denis bridged Impressionism and modern abstraction, making Rotterdam a fascinating study in transitional aesthetics—where observed reality dissolves into lyrical patterning while retaining a palpable sense of place. Though less celebrated than his religious murals, this urban landscape reveals his mastery in balancing observation with poetic stylization.
